With six billion plus people on planet earth, many who cannot read or write, how can they ever hear the plan of redemption and the story of Jesus creating the world, dying on the cross and coming again? One tremendous tool is the Mega Voice solar-powered handheld audio Bible.
For $30 per unit it is possible to mass produce a simple, hard-shelled unit, powered by solar power alone, that “speaks” the Bible in the language of various groups around the world. The North Pacific Union Conference is cooperating with serveral church organizations* to produce Mega Voice Bibles that include an outline of the Life of Jesus and the Story of Redepmtion, Steps to Jesus (a simplified version of Steps to Christ), a series of Bible study guides and the entire New Testament. A speaker can be attached so that the message can be played to a large group of people.
As groups take mission trips around the world, such as the Philippines for Christ 2008 trip next March, wouldn’t it be wonderful to leave behind a Mega Voice unit for each Bible worker and village where we have been? Is it possible to get the solar Bible in the Lao language? Hmong would also be helpful.
We have been working with an SDA pastor in Laos who has translated Steps to Christ and the Passion of Love (last 13 chapters of Desire of Ages) into Lao. STC has already been approved by the govt. censors for publication and the Passion is in the process of being approved.
He is very proficient in about 6 languages (Thai, Russian, English, French, etc.) and could be most useful for recording if needed.
